
After an early spell in the Academy set-up at Wanderers, Morley returned to the club in January, 2022 with more than 120 senior appearances under his belt thanks to a successful start to his senior career with Rochdale.
His stay with the Whites could then be split into two parts with a flying start tapering off in the 2023/24 season when he struggled to hold down a regular starting slot.
A loan move to Wycombe Wanderers in the first half of the 2024/25 season got the midfield play-maker firmly back on track as he returned to the Toughsheet Community Stadium in January, 2025 to re-assert himself as one of the Whites’ main men.
His form in the second half of the campaign – before a late injury at Barnsley kept him out of the final few games – earned Morley the Players’ Player of the Season award as he clocked up 100 starts for the Whites.
